MODBUS协议有哪几种
的有关信息介绍如下:Modbus协议目前存在用于串口、以太网以及盾其他支持互联网协议的网络的版本。
1、对于串行连接,存在两个变种,它们在数值数据表示不同和协议细节上略有不同。被要剧边要ModbusRTU是一种紧凑的则,采用二进制表示数据氢留的方式,ModbusASCII是一种人类可读的,冗长的表示方式。这两个变种都使用验福执看宗置夜率串行通信(serial展因言民济communication)方式。
RTU格式后续的命令/数据带有循环冗余校验的校验和,而ASCII格式采用纵向冗余校验的校验和。被配置为RTU变种的节点不会和设置为ASCII变种的节点通信,反之亦然。
2、对于通过TCP/IP(例如以太网)的连接促作六妈级迫,存在多个Modbus/TCP变种,这种方式不需要校验和计算。
3、Modbus有一个扩展版本ModbusPlus(Modbus+或者MB+),不过此协议是Modicon专有的,和Modbu门快争掌s不同。它需要一个专门的协处理器来处理类似HDLC的高速程征轻令牌旋转。
它使用1Mbit/s的双绞线,并且每个节点都有转换隔离装置,是一种采用转换/边缘触发而不是电压/水平触发的装置。连接ModbusPlus到计算机需要特别的接口,通常是支持ISA(SA85),PCI或者PMCIA总线的板卡。
对于所有的这三种通信协议在数据模型和功能调用上都是相同的,只有封装方式是不同的。
扩展资料:
其它通讯成深洲增省协议
1、RS-2精32通讯协议
RS-232是一种串行物理接口标准。RS是英文“推荐标准”的缩写,232为标识号通钱家巴工小欢常。RS-232接口以9个引脚(DB-9)或是25个引脚(DB-25)的型态出现。
2、RS-485通讯协议
RS-485标准是在RS232的基础上发展怕财奏来的,增加了多点、双向通信能力句色牛施呀门父已束,即允许多个发送器连接到同一条总线上,同时增加了发送器的驱动能力和冲突保护特性,扩展了总线共模范围,后刘业硫源号受氢个征命名为TIA/EIA-485-A标准。
3、Ethernet通讯协议
以太网(Ethernet)指的是基带局域网规范玉响树声资穿引,是当今现有局域网采用的最通用的通信协议标准。以太网络使用CSMA/CD毫言技术,并以10M/S的速率运行在多种类型的电缆上。以太网与IEEE802.3系史气列标准相类似。
参考资料来源:百度百科-Modbus通讯协议